What is a 20ft Open Top Shipping Container?
A 20ft open top shipping container is similar to a basic shipping container in regards to dimensions but lacks a strong roofing. Rather, it includes a resilient tarpaulin cover that can be eliminated or protected throughout transit. This design allows for taller or awkwardly shaped freight that would not fit in a conventional container, making it a versatile option for numerous markets.

Applications of 20ft Open Top Shipping Containers
The adaptability of the 20ft open top shipping container means it can be used throughout numerous industries. Here are some common applications:

Construction Materials: Transporting oversized products such as pipelines, steel beams, and scaffolding.

Machinery and Equipment: Ideal for shipping heavy equipment or non-traditional tools that can't suit basic containers.

Bulk Commodities: Suitable for bulk materials that are difficult to load through standard entrances, such as bagged goods or granules.

Project Logistics: Often used in project-based logistics, such as oil and gas operations or massive infrastructure tasks.
